#4f8b2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f8b2c is composed of 31% red, 54.5%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.3%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 97.9 degrees, a saturation of 51.9% and a lightness of 35.9%. #4f8b2c color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ff58 with #001700.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#4f8b2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f8b2c has RGB values of R:79, G:139,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 5212972.

Shades and Tints of #4f8b2c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030502 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f8b2c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a6156 is the less saturated color, while #44b502 is the most saturated one.
